Managing Parkinson's Symptoms: Strategies for Everyday Life

Living with Parkinson's disease can bring about a variety of symptoms that impact daily life. Luckily, there are many strategies you can implement to effectively manage these challenges and improve your quality of life.

It's crucial to discuss your doctor to create a personalized plan that addresses your individual needs. They can recommend on medications, therapies, and lifestyle changes that prove beneficial.

Consider incorporating the following strategies into your daily:

  • Frequent exercise can aid in improving movement, reducing stiffness, and boosting mood.
  • The bal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ains can enhance overall health and well-being.
  • Joining in social activities can minimize feelings of isolation and boost your spirits.
  • Practicing relaxation techniques, such as deep breathing or meditation, can ease stress and anxiety.

Seeking Relief: Effective Treatments for Parkinson's Disease

Living with Parkinson's disease can present significant challenges, but effective treatments are available to alleviate symptoms and improve quality of life. A variety of approaches can prove helpful, including medication, physical therapy, and lifestyle modifications.

Medications like levodopa operate by increasing dopamine levels in the brain, which helps to alleviate tremors, stiffness, and slow movement. Physical therapy plays a crucial role in maintaining strength, flexibility, and balance, while also enhancing coordination and mobility.

In addition to these traditional treatments, emerging therapies including deep brain stimulation (DBS) are showing promising results in providing symptom relief. DBS involves implanting electrodes in the brain to control abnormal nerve activity. While there is no cure for Parkinson's disease, a combination of these treatments can website help individuals live meaningful lives despite their condition.

It's important to consult with a medical professional to identify the best treatment plan tailored to your individual needs and situation. With proper management, people with Parkinson's disease can remain active, engaged, and hopeful about the future.
